Garment care considers the whole item: fabric, lining, closures, trim, embellishment, structure, stains, wear, and the manufacturer's instructions. A clear intake conversation helps surface details that are easy to miss.

Protecting shape, finish, and wearability begins before cleaning starts.
Some concerns are cosmetic while others involve weakened fabric or construction. Cleaning cannot reverse every form of age, abrasion, fading, shrinkage, or previous damage, so expectations should be discussed before service.
Condition matters as much as category. Age, abrasion, fading, weakened fibers, missing labels, old stains, adhesives, decorative finishes, and prior cleaning can change what is possible. Professional care may improve appearance and readiness for use, but it cannot make every form of wear or damage disappear.

Before drop-off.
Keep labels attached, identify fragile areas, and bring belts or matching pieces when they should be handled together. Use a breathable garment cover for storage after cleaning.
At intake, review the requested work, visible concerns, handling limitations, current price, and expected collection date. Keep the receipt and contact the store if your plans change.

Can I treat a stain first?
Blotting guidance depends on the material. Avoid unknown products or heat, and disclose anything already applied.
